TECALEMIT’s Hornet W85 Diesel Transfer Pump – A Work Horse

TECALEMIT's Hornet W85 Diesel Transfer Pump - A Work Horse

TECALEMIT’s Hornet W85 transfer pump is built to get the job done. It’s been powering the industry for 10 years with its reliability and strength. Compared to other pumps on the market, which only produce around 1700 RPM, the Hornet W85’s motor races ahead at a staggering 10,000 RPMs. So how is having such a powerful motor beneficial?

TECALEMIT’s Hornet W85 Diesel Transfer Pump – Ditch the Heavy Pumps and Make Your Life Easier

TECALEMIT's Hornet W85 Diesel Transfer Pump - Ditch the Heavy Pumps and Make Your Life Easier

TECALEMIT’s Hornet W85 Diesel transfer pump is a gem – it’s lightweight, the pump itself only weighing 10 pounds! Now, you may be thinking, how well can such a light pump work? How well can it stand up to the daily work? This one sentence sums it up: we don’t sell repair kits for it.
